Picture windows are fixed units with no moving sash, so they offer the largest clear span of glass and the most daylight of any window — the right call for a feature wall rather than one you need to open. In Caldwell, that suits a downtown bungalow near the College of Idaho or a farmhouse rolling toward Sunnyslope wine country. Because nothing operates, there's no seal to leak, so a fixed unit posts some of the lowest air-infiltration numbers available — a real gain over the worn aluminum windows common on older Caldwell homes. Iron Crest Exteriors typically flanks the picture pane with operable casements for ventilation and tunes the SHGC to the dry, sun-heavy valley floor so the glass performs without overheating.

Our process
How picture windows works in Caldwell
- 01
On-site measure & assessment
We measure the opening, check the surrounding wall for rot or moisture, and plan any operable companion units before quoting a firm price.
- 02
Glass & frame selection
We match U-factor and especially SHGC to the elevation — critical on a large pane — and explain vinyl, fiberglass, and composite frame options.
- 03
Remove old units & inspect
Old windows come out and we inspect the rough opening, addressing any rot or water damage before the new unit is set.
- 04
Set, flash & insulate
The fixed unit is set level and square, flashed and air-sealed to the weather barrier, and insulated so its low air-infiltration performance is achieved.
- 05
Trim, seal & walkthrough
We finish interior and exterior trim, seal joints, confirm any companion units operate smoothly, and walk the job with you before closeout.

Are picture windows a sensible swap for the old single-pane aluminum windows on my older Caldwell home?
On the right wall, very much so. Caldwell's older homes frequently carry single-pane aluminum that conducts heat, sweats in winter, and leaks air at every joint. A fixed picture unit replaces that with insulated low-E glass and no operating seal to fail, so it dramatically tightens a prominent wall. Where the old window provided your only ventilation in that room, we keep airflow by pairing the picture pane with operable casements, and we inspect the rough opening for rot before setting the new unit.

Do picture windows open?
No — they're fixed units with no operating sash, which is exactly why they offer the largest unbroken pane and the lowest air leakage. If you want ventilation on that wall, we pair the picture window with operable casements or double-hungs flanking it.
Are picture windows energy-efficient?
Yes — with no operating seal to leak, they post some of the lowest air-infiltration and U-factor numbers of any window type. The key on a large pane is choosing the right SHGC so a south- or west-facing unit doesn't gain too much solar heat in summer.
